A "philosophical novel" by Jules Tellier (1863-1889), wherein "an old scholar in Algeria.grapples with his inner conflicts concerning faith as he faces his mortality. The novel explores themes of religious doubt, the search for truth, and the contrasting concepts of paradise in Christianity and Islam." (n.b., quotes from the web site of Project Gutenberg). With four wood engravings by Paul Nash (1889-1946), considered "one of the more important and influential painters in Britain in the 20th century.In addition to painting, Nash illustrated nearly twenty books and.[t]his work forms an important part of his artistic output." (n.b., from Horne, p. 332). ___DESCRIPTION: Quarter bound in blue buckram with sides of marbled paper over boards, gilt lettering on the spine, wood-engraved frontis by Nash, a small Nash wood engraving on the title page, two more full-page wood engravings bound in; Caslon O.F. type on English hand-made paper, octavo size (8 78" by 5 7/8"), pagination: [i-ii] 1-34 [1, colophon]; limited edition of 400 copies (per the colophon; Chanticleer states 500), this no. 169.
